## Tuning

Statusbeagle, our deploy-status bot, is mostly set-and-forget, but a few knobs matter. The poll interval trades freshness against API quota on the Lintport CI server — too eager and we get throttled mid-release, too lazy and folks ask "is it out yet?" in chat. Debounce keeps duplicate announcements down. If you touch anything, touch these, and leave a note in the changelog. Current values are below.

tuning constants:
QUOTAS = {
    "druwyn": 5,
    "holix": 5,
    "zorath": 5,
    "holwyn": 10,
}

## Idempotency Keys for Payment Retries (Lumopay)

Every retry of a charge request must reuse the original idempotency key; generating a new key on retry can produce duplicate charges. Keys are scoped per merchant and expire after 48 hours. Reviewers should verify keys are derived server-side, never from client input. The full key-generation specification and threat model are maintained on the internal page.

dashboard of kaguf-tawip = https://vault.merlaqsys.test/issue

## Step 4: Connection Pooling

As part of the Veltrix migration, the Ordanto billing service moves from per-request connections to a managed pool. Pool credentials are rotated by the Hollow Pine vault sidecar, and idle connections are reaped after sixty seconds. Reviewers should confirm that the pool size caps below the database's hard limit and that TLS is enforced on every connection. The pool settings applied in staging are listed below.

service settings:
[casax]
port = 6379
team = rusir
host = casax.zemvarhq.corp
region = outer-4
access_code = ac_9808ce
timeout_ms = 1500

Report exports in Kestrelboard always render timestamps in the workspace's configured timezone, never the viewer's. DST transitions are resolved at export time; re-running an export can shift row boundaries. Exports spanning a timezone change are capped in row count, and scheduled exports queue per region. Per-workspace limits and the scheduler's quota constants are shown below.

tuning table, kajog-bawip:
TIERS = {
    "kelius": 256,
    "lammir": 543,
}